Why sunroom × Dallas produces this band

A sunroom scope for a home addition in Dallas combines two price levers: scope and metro labor rates. Sunrooms are three-season or four-season enclosed spaces with large glazed walls. Three-season sunrooms skip HVAC and insulated envelope (faster, cheaper); four-season sunrooms meet full code and are treated as conditioned living space. Against the national median remodel labor rate, Dallas runs 8% below the national median — so the sunroom band comes in 50% below the mid-range, then scales 8% below the national median on top of that. Permit timelines for residential work in Dallas typically run 3-8 weeks, which is the window you plan your design and decision sequence against.
